Biblical Concordance

1 Peter 2:24 He himself bore our sins in his body on the tree so that we, having died to sins, might live to righteousness (dikaiosynē | δικαιοσύνῃ | dat sg fem). By his wounds you were healed.
1 Peter 3:14 But even if you should suffer because of righteousness (dikaiosynēn | δικαιοσύνην | acc sg fem), blessed are you. And do not fear their threats or be troubled,
2 Peter 1:1 Simon Peter, a servant and apostle of Jesus Christ, to those who have received a faith that through the justice (dikaiosynē | δικαιοσύνῃ | dat sg fem) of our God and Savior Jesus Christ is of equal privilege with ours:
2 Peter 2:5 and if he did not spare the ancient world (but preserved Noah, the eighth, a herald of righteousness) (dikaiosynēs | δικαιοσύνης | gen sg fem) when he brought the deluge on an ungodly world;
2 Peter 2:21 For it would have been better for them never to have come to know the way of righteousness (dikaiosynēs | δικαιοσύνης | gen sg fem) than, having come to know it, to turn back from the holy commandment that was delivered to them.
2 Peter 3:13 But according to his promise we are waiting for new heavens and a new earth in which righteousness (dikaiosynē | δικαιοσύνη | nom sg fem) will be at home.
1 John 2:29 If you know that he is righteous, you also know that everyone who practices righteousness (dikaiosynēn | δικαιοσύνην | acc sg fem) has been born of him.
1 John 3:7 Little children, let no one deceive you. Whoever makes it a practice to do what is right (dikaiosynēn | δικαιοσύνην | acc sg fem) is righteous, just as he is righteous.
1 John 3:10 By this the children of God and the children of the devil are revealed: whoever does not practice righteousness (dikaiosynēn | δικαιοσύνην | acc sg fem) is not of God, nor is the one who does not love his brother.
Revelation 19:11 Then I saw heaven opened, and behold, a white horse! The one riding it is called Faithful and True, and with justice (dikaiosynē | δικαιοσύνῃ | dat sg fem) he judges and makes war.
Revelation 22:11 Let the evildoer continue to do evil, and the filthy be filthy still; let the righteous continue to act righteously (dikaiosynēn | δικαιοσύνην | acc sg fem), and the holy be holy still.”
